The Ultimate Guide to Making Molds for Plastic: Step-by-Step Tutorial

Creating a precise mold for plastic is the foundational step in transforming a design concept into a tangible, repeatable part. Whether you are prototyping a custom enclosure, producing small batches of components, or exploring creative projects, understanding the core principles of mold making unlocks a world of manufacturing possibilities. This process involves capturing the exact geometry of an original model, known as the master or pattern, and then creating a flexible or rigid negative form that plastic material can be forced into or cast against.

Understanding the Fundamentals of Plastic Mold Creation

At its core, making a mold for plastic is about creating a sealed cavity that mirrors the desired final shape. The choice of mold type—such as a single-part block mold, a multi-part cast mold, or a layered silicone matrix—depends heavily on the complexity of the object, the production volume, and the specific plastic resin being used. Mastering this craft requires attention to detail, from selecting the right master model to ensuring proper venting and release characteristics.

Selecting and Preparing the Master Model

The master model is the physical object from which the mold will be made, and its quality directly dictates the quality of the plastic copies. Surfaces should be smooth, well-finished, and free of imperfections that could transfer to the final part. It is crucial to consider draft angles, undercuts, and dimensional tolerance during this stage. A model with intricate details or deep recesses will demand a more flexible mold material, like silicone, to ensure successful de-molding without damage.

Choosing the Right Mold Making Material

The selection of the mold-making material is a critical decision that balances cost, durability, and flexibility. For complex, low-volume parts, silicone rubber is often the preferred choice due to its ability to capture fine details and conform to undercuts. For higher-volume applications requiring greater rigidity and heat resistance, materials like polyurethane resin or even metal alloys might be necessary. The chosen material must be chemically compatible with the plastic being processed to prevent adhesion or degradation.

Step-by-Step Fabrication Process

The actual fabrication typically begins with constructing a mold box or flask to contain the molding material around the master model. The model is then securely positioned, often using double-sided tape or a removable adhesive. The liquid molding material is carefully mixed to eliminate air bubbles and poured or brushed onto the model in controlled layers. This process, sometimes involving multiple pours and curing cycles, builds up the mold walls to the necessary thickness for structural integrity.

Ensuring Optimal Results and Part Release

One of the most crucial aspects of mold making is designing an effective release system. This includes incorporating features like draft angles on the master model and applying appropriate release agents to prevent the cured plastic from sticking to the mold. Strategic venting is also essential to allow trapped air to escape, preventing voids, bubbles, or incomplete fills in the final plastic part. Neglecting these details can lead to production delays and wasted materials.

Final Considerations for Quality and Longevity

Once the mold has fully cured and been demolded, it requires careful cleaning and inspection to remove any residue or imperfections from the fabrication process. Testing the mold with a small trial shot of the intended plastic resin is a vital step to verify dimensional accuracy, surface finish, and structural performance. Proper maintenance, including thorough cleaning after each use and safe storage, will extend the mold's lifespan and ensure consistent results across numerous production cycles.
